2013 Women's Lacrosse Roster

6 Sophia Thomas

  • Class Senior
  • High School Maryvale Prep
  • Hometown Lutherville, Md.

Biography

2012- A Second Team All-America honoree ... Named First Team All-South Region ... Earned First Team All-BIG EAST ... A Tewaaraton Trophy Nominee ... Named BIG EAST Offensive Player of the Week and had a spot on the weekly honor roll ... Appeared in all 17 games with nine starts to her credit ... Led the Hoyas with 46 points on a team-best 38 goals and eight assists ... Fourth on the squad in caused turnovers with 18 ... Picked up 17 ground balls and had 14 draw controls ... Scored three games winners on the season including Delaware, North Carolina and Penn, two of the victories were over ranked opponents ... Notched six goals and one assist in the Penn win ... Had five goals and an assists in the win at Louisville ... Scored four goals against Loyola (Md.)... Managed four draw controls at Syracuse ... Caused four turnovers against Delaware in the season opener.

2011- A Third Team All-America selection ... Won BIG EAST Midfielder of the Year and a First Team All-BIG EAST honoree ... Named All-South Region ... A three-time BIG EAST Weekly Honor Roll recipient ... Ranked 21st in career caused turnovers with 56 ... Tied for ninth all time with 33 caused turnovers in a season ... Appeared in all 17 games with 10 starts to her credit ... Led the Hoyas in goals with 37 as well as eight assists for 45 points to rank second in scoring ... Picked up a squad-best 42 ground balls and ranked third on draw controls with 24 ... Defensively, caused a team-high 33 turnovers ... Tallied six goals in the win over Connecticut as well as five goals in the Louisville victory ... Scored in every game but one with multiple goals in 10 contests ... Notched the game winner against Connecticut ... Had five ground balls against Rutgers and multiple pick ups on 13 occasions ... Tallied four draw controls against Northwestern ... Posted seven caused turnovers in the Louisville victory.

2010 - Won the Sheehan Stanwick Rookie of the Year Award ... Appeared in all 19 games ... Was fifth on the squad with 18 goals and sixth in points with 20 ... Ranked second on the team with 33 ground balls and 23 caused turnovers ... Picked up four ground balls in each of the games against Syracuse, Louisville and North Carolina.

Prior to Georgetown - A First Team All-American at Maryvale Prep ... Selected as Baltimore Sun All-Metro in 2009 ... Tabbed All-Baltimore County for three-consecutive seasons ... A two-time high school MVP ... Played club with classmates Abbie Bisbee and Kelsi Bozel for TLC ... Voted as her class representative for four years ... An all-conference soccer player.
